महाभारतः       mahābhārataḥ - book-3, chapter-40, verse-9

गाण्डीवं धनुरादाय शरांश्चाशीविषोपमान् ।
सज्यं धनुर्वरं कृत्वा ज्याघोषेण निनादयन् ॥९॥
9. gāṇḍīvaṁ dhanurādāya śarāṁścāśīviṣopamān ,
sajyaṁ dhanurvaraṁ kṛtvā jyāghoṣeṇa ninādayan.
9. gāṇḍīvam dhanuḥ ādāya śarān ca āśīviṣopamān
sajyam dhanurvaram kṛtvā jyāghoṣeṇa ninādayan
9. Taking up the Gāṇḍīva bow and arrows that resembled venomous snakes, and having strung that excellent bow, he made it resound with the twang of its string.

Words meanings and morphology

गाण्डीवम् (gāṇḍīvam) - Gāṇḍīva (Arjuna's bow)
(proper noun)
Accusative, neuter, singular of gāṇḍīva
gāṇḍīva - name of Arjuna's bow
धनुः (dhanuḥ) - bow
(noun)
Accusative, neuter, singular of dhanus
dhanus - bow, weapon, arc
आदाय (ādāya) - having taken, taking up
(indeclinable)
absolutive
root dā (to give/take) with prefix ā, forming an absolutive
Prefix: ā
Root: dā (class 3)
शरान् (śarān) - arrows
(noun)
Accusative, masculine, plural of śara
śara - arrow, reed, water
(ca) - and
(indeclinable)
आशीविषोपमान् (āśīviṣopamān) - resembling venomous snakes
(adjective)
Accusative, masculine, plural of āśīviṣopama
āśīviṣopama - similar to a venomous snake
Compound type : upameyatatpuruṣa (āśīviṣa+upama)
  • āśīviṣa – venomous snake, serpent
    noun (masculine)
  • upama – similar, resembling, comparison, simile
    adjective (masculine)
सज्यम् (sajyam) - strung (with a bowstring)
(adjective)
Accusative, neuter, singular of sajya
sajya - with a bowstring, strung
Compound type : bahuvrīhi (sa+jyā)
  • sa – with, together with
    indeclinable
  • jyā – bowstring
    noun (feminine)
धनुर्वरम् (dhanurvaram) - excellent bow, best bow
(noun)
Accusative, neuter, singular of dhanurvara
dhanurvara - excellent bow
Compound type : karmadhāraya (dhanus+vara)
  • dhanus – bow
    noun (neuter)
  • vara – excellent, best, boon
    adjective (masculine)
कृत्वा (kṛtvā) - having made, making
(indeclinable)
absolutive
absolutive from root kṛ
Root: kṛ (class 8)
ज्याघोषेण (jyāghoṣeṇa) - by the twang of the bowstring
(noun)
Instrumental, masculine, singular of jyāghoṣa
jyāghoṣa - sound of a bowstring, bowstring's twang
Compound type : ṣaṣṭhī-tatpuruṣa (jyā+ghoṣa)
  • jyā – bowstring
    noun (feminine)
  • ghoṣa – sound, noise, roar, twang
    noun (masculine)
निनादयन् (ninādayan) - making resound, causing to sound
(adjective)
Nominative, masculine, singular of ninādayat
ninādayat - making a sound, causing to resound
present active participle (causative)
From root nad (to sound) in the causative stem, forming a present active participle
Prefix: ni
Root: nad (class 1)
Note: Implied subject, referring to Arjuna.
